The Deer Hunter franchise is considered the most realistic, accurate and addictive deer hunting game in the market. Deer Hunter has been the leading hunting brand since 1997 and has sold more than 4.6 million games through 2003.
"Sorrent understands that mobile gamers are like PC or console gamers -- they demand the same adventure and excitement on mobile that they enjoy on other platforms," said Wim Stocks, EVP of sales and marketing for Atari, Inc. "For a key title like Deer Hunter, we found a partner in Sorrent who will maximize the mobile phone's capabilities and deliver the high-quality gameplay that our loyal customers value."
Deer Hunter will be available on major wireless carriers around the world in Q3 of 2004.
About Sorrent, Inc.
Sorrent is a leading creator and global publisher of wireless entertainment. Sorrent's critically-acclaimed mobile content features community, entertainment and games based on original and licensed properties. Sorrent has partnered with major consumer brands, including Atari, FOX Sports and Viacom to extend their leading brands to the mobile lifestyle. Sorrent has developed a proprietary technology infrastructure that delivers graphically rich applications to more than 100 Java and BREW-enabled handsets. The company's extensive distribution network includes international and US wireless carriers, such as Verizon Wireless, Sprint, AT&T Wireless, Cingular, Nextel, T-Mobile and Boost Mobile.
